What they do

The Mission of The IICRC is to Establish and Advance Globally Recognized Standards and Certifications for The Inspection, Cleaning, Restoration and Installation Industries.See Schedule O

Money in and money out

Revenue$8,965,057
Expenses$6,298,791
Annual surplus $2,666,266 Revenue was higher than expenses for this filing year.
